Kinds of Welding Qualifications
Despite the fact that the AWS’ regular CW (Certified Welder) certificate helps make you eligible for almost all employment opportunities, certain industries require a certain certification. Examples of the most-widely used of these are listed below.
- ASME Certification for welders who work on boiler and pressure vessels
- Certified Welder Certification to become a Certified Welder
- API Certification for welders that work on pipelines in the energy field
- SCWI and CWI Certifications for inspectors and senior inspectors

Typical Welding Programs
You’ve made up your mind that you might want to be a welder, so soon you should select which of the welding schools is the perfect one. The first step in starting up your career as a welding specialist is to pick which of the top welding training will help you. Initially, you should really make sure that the program has been certified by the American Welding Society. Just after looking into the accreditation status, you really should investigate slightly further to make certain that the classes you are considering can provide you with the right instruction.
- Be sure the college’s curriculum features courses in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
- Watch for courses that meet AWS SENSE standards
- Determine if the college offers financial aid
- Make certain the institution teaches with tools that satisfies up-to-date field guidelines
